Understanding Lawn Mower Battery Types
Most modern lawn mowers use one of three battery types: Lithium-ion (Li-ion), Nickel-Cadmium (Ni-Cd), or Lead-Acid. Chinese manufacturers have particularly excelled in producing high-quality Li-ion batteries that offer excellent energy density and longer cycle life.
Lithium-ion Batteries
- Lightweight and compact
- No memory effect
- Longer lifespan (typically 500-1000 cycles)
Best Practices for Battery Charging
Proper charging habits can significantly extend your battery’s life. Follow these guidelines for optimal battery health:
- Always use the manufacturer-approved charger (many Chinese-made mowers include specialized charging systems)
- Avoid exposing batteries to extreme temperatures during charging
- Don’t leave batteries on the charger indefinitely after full charge
Storage Tips for Off-Season
When storing your lawn mower for extended periods (especially important in regions with winter seasons):
- Charge the battery to about 50% before storage
- Store in a cool, dry place (between 32°F and 77°F)
- Check charge level every 2-3 months and recharge if below 30%
Troubleshooting Common Battery Issues
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
---|---|---|
Battery won’t hold charge | Deep discharge, old age | Try full discharge/recharge cycle or replace |
Battery gets hot during use | Overworking, bad cells | Allow to cool, check for manufacturer warranty |

Environmental Considerations
Proper battery disposal is crucial for environmental protection. Many Chinese manufacturers now offer recycling programs for their lithium-ion batteries. Always dispose of old batteries at authorized collection points rather than throwing them in regular trash.
Professional Maintenance Tips
For optimal battery performance, consider these professional recommendations:
- Clean battery terminals quarterly with a dry cloth
- Inspect for physical damage before each use
- Keep battery firmware updated (for smart batteries)
- Rotate between multiple batteries if possible
When to Replace Your Lawn Mower Battery
Typical signs that your battery needs replacement include:
- Reduced runtime (less than 70% of original)
- Difficulty holding charge overnight
- Visible swelling or physical damage
- Error messages from smart battery systems
